走啊走
加油

腾讯云mysql2核4G?

服务器价格表

结论:腾讯云MySQL 2核4G配置适合中小型业务场景,但需根据实际负载、数据量和性能需求综合评估,必要时可通过读写分离或升级配置优化性能。

1. 配置适用场景分析

  • 中小型Web应用/博客:日均访问量1万以下、数据量小于10GB时,2核4G可满足基本查询和事务处理需求。
  • 开发测试环境:适合团队开发、功能测试,成本低且易于管理。
  • 轻量级电商/CRM系统:低并发订单处理(如每秒TPS<50)或用户数<5000的场景。

2. 性能瓶颈与风险

  • CPU压力
    • 高并发查询或复杂JOIN操作可能导致CPU利用率超过80%,引发响应延迟。建议通过slow_query_log监控慢SQL。
    • 批量数据导入/导出时可能出现短暂性能下降。
  • 内存限制
    • InnoDB缓冲池默认占用约3GB(75%内存),剩余内存可能不足支撑连接池(每个连接约2-10MB)。
    • 建议通过innodb_buffer_pool_size调整至2.5GB左右,预留内存给其他进程。

3. 优化建议

  • SQL与索引优化
    • 使用EXPLAIN分析查询计划,避免全表扫描。
    • 对高频查询字段建立复合索引(如(user_id, create_time))。
  • 参数调优
    innodb_flush_log_at_trx_commit = 2  # 非X_X业务可牺牲部分持久性换性能
    max_connections = 200              # 根据实际连接数调整,避免OOM
  • 架构扩展
    • 读写分离:通过腾讯云只读实例分担查询压力(成本增加约30%)。
    • 连接池:使用ProxySQL或应用层连接池减少短连接开销。

4. 监控与升级时机

  • 关键指标阈值
    • CPU持续>70%
    • 内存使用>90%
    • 磁盘IOPS>基础版限速(如2000 IOPS)
  • 升级方案
    • 垂直升级:4核8G可提升约2倍吞吐量。
    • 水平分库:数据量超500GB时考虑分片。

5. 腾讯云特有优势

  • 自动备份与灾备:免费每日冷备+Binlog日志,支持秒级回档。
  • SSD云盘性能:基础版提供约1000-6000 IOPS,优于自建机械硬盘。
  • 一键只读实例:无需运维介入,适合快速扩展读能力。

核心建议2核4G是成本与性能的折中选择,但业务增长至日均PV超5万或数据量达50GB时,必须升级配置或优化架构。长期运行需结合腾讯云监控API设置自动化告警规则。